Mark Smith Appointed to Texas Private Security Board
On December 14, 2007, Texas Governor Rick Perry announced
to Secretary of State Phil Wilson the appointment of
Company President Mark L. Smith to the Texas Department
of Public Safety Private Security Board. The Texas
Private Security Board governs the licensing and
regulation of all private security companies and personnel
in the State of Texas.
Mark Smith brings to the appointment a family heritage of
over 100 years in the private security business in Texas.
In addition, Mark is a Life Member of Associated Security
Services and Investigators of the State of Texas
(A.S.S.I.S.T.), the industry association that was
instrumental in establishing the licensing agency itself.
Since then, Mark has continued to work with the State
Legislature to raise the level of professionalism for the
security industry in the State.
Seeing a need for enhanced cooperation between private
security and law enforcement in order to protect the
citizens of Texas, Mark served on the original Steering
Committee to form Law Enforcement and Private Security
(L.E.A.P.S.) in Dallas, an organization dedicated to
cooperation between private security and local police
forces through workshops, symposiums, and information
sharing. L.E.A.P.S. organizations have subsequently
formed in other cities such as Houston, El Paso, and
more. The L.E.A.P.S. movement has generated national
interest.
